Well, known crashes to me:
1. Lebisey crashed when map fully loaded (100% then CTD).The map has no navmesh.Fixed by Remick04 1st Fix
The map is now playable.2. Operation Totalize-64 will eventually crash.
As long as the Canadians don't take the Windmill flag, all will be fine. But then, I play as Canadian and rushed all the way to the windmill (numerous times), and 3 times playing, all end up with this error message:
3. Operation Goodwood-64 displays dummy flags capture message.
4. Anctoville 1944-64 displays "ERROR when dealing with (certain object)"
The message will appear periodically, but doesn't affect anything to my observation. The game still plays well and the bots will do their job.
5. Port-en-Bessin MG34 gun position in a house adjacent to the Shipyard makes player stuck

5. Bots driving vehicle in Operation Goodwood cannot cross railroad underpass and overpass.
The Germans are pretty much stuck in Goodwood, their counterattack only come with infantries and small armour units. Investigation leads me to their base: they forward and reverse the tanks and halftracks too much, afraid hitting the underpass wall. Probably their collision mesh avoidance played a part in this. Otherwise, we can "waypoint path" this underpasses and overpasses so bots can drive over them easily into the fight.Fixed by Void's ESAI FH2 edition6.
